    <title>Jul 3, Popular Dorset Writer Bob Westwood launches walking tour company</title>
    <link>http://www.the-dorset-guru.com/Dorset-blog.html#Popular-Dorset-Writer-Bob-Westwood-launches-walking-tour-company</link>
    <description>Writer and photographer Bob Westwood has been walking the Purbecks for many years. Trained as a geologist at Exeter University, and having recently retired from teaching, he produces a range of popular guides that are stocked in National Trust shops and tourism centres across the county. This year he has also written the new Jurassic Coast walking guides for the Jurassic Coast Trust , published by Coastal Publishing.

Purbeck, sitting in the heart of the Jurassic Coast (a Unesco World Heritage site), has been inspiration for artists such as Paul Nash and writer Thomas Hardy, and is a haven for some of the UKs rarest species of wildlife.  It is a Mecca for those looking for outdoors breaks, where they can enjoy sailing, cycling, horse riding and in particular walking.  

Already involved in walking groups, and with the recent success of this years 1st Swanage and Purbeck Walking Festival, Bob has now launched Jurassic Coast Walking www.jurassiccoastwalking.co.uk, a tailor-made tour company, giving an insiders guide to the area. Guests will be encouraged to take up the opportunity of a car free break, travelling by rail (only 2  hours from London Waterloo), with collection from main line stations as well as flights into Bournemouth Airport. Linking in with local accommodation providers such as the beautiful Kingston Country Courtyard and The Scott Arms, guests will return after an active day out to fantastic local food and 4 * comfort; the essence being: leave your city stresses and your car, and get away from it all.

 Bob says:
  Purbeck is an absolute jewel in the South Coast, and of such importance geologically.  Many people visit the area to walk but possibly dont know much about how this wonderful landscape has been formed, or miss a great deal of whats on offer.  I want to give them a bit more to think about whilst they are here. The tours will be informal but informative, I hope people will go home feeling they have learnt something.  

Bob also hopes Jurassic Coast Walking will appeal to special interest groups such as photographers and historians. 

We really want to be as bespoke as possible</description>

    <title>Mar 29, The perils of fossil hunting</title>
    <link>http://www.the-dorset-guru.com/Dorset-blog.html#The-perils-of-fossil-hunting</link>
    <description>The BBC reports a 12 year old boy had to be rescued from mud caused by a landslide at Charmouth on the Jurassic Coast.

The cliffs here are very unstable and this incident highlights the need to be very careful when looking for fossils.

Don&#39;t hack away at the cliff face.Just pick over what has already come away.You will find something</description>

    <title>Mar 8, An invitation to explore Swanage &amp; Purbeck &amp; the stunning Jurassic Coast  The First Purbeck Walking Festival  May 3rd May 7th 2010</title>
    <link>http://www.the-dorset-guru.com/Dorset-blog.html#An-invitation-to-explore-Swanage-&amp;-Purbeck-&amp;-the-stunning-Jurassic-Coast-The-First-Purbeck-Walking-Festival-May-3rd-May-7th-2010</link>
    <description>The  annual Swanage &amp; Purbeck Walking Festival is now an essential event for the spring calendar for walkers of all abilities. 
Only 2.5 hours from London Waterloo, and a World Heritage site, the Purbecks are blessed with breathtaking scenery such as the chalk cliffs around the Studland peninsular, historic villages such as Corfe Castle, and the hidden coves of Chapmans Pool and Kimmeridge Bay. Miles of coastal and countryside paths make for unrivalled walking, as well as bird and wildlife watching, particularly as the area is home to many rare species.

A varied programme will be running throughout the week which has been specifically designed to cater for a wide range of interests and abilities as well as giving an insight into the areas fascinating history.  Local and specialist guides will be on hand to reveal the delights and secrets of the area, and Festival participants will able to take advantage of inclusive steam rail travel on Swanages world famous steam railway as well as sample some of the delicious local Purbeck produce and finest ales with inclusive pub lunches in some instances.

The festival organisers have joined forces with specialist walking company HF Holidays, the UKs leading provider of outdoor, walking and activity breaks who have been coming to the area for many years.

Alan Power chair of the hospitality association and festival co-ordinator said:

We are absolutely delighted to have HF Holidays on-board, they have a wealth of experience, which should make the festival a great success, and which we hope will be an annual event.
